Step 1: Identify Key Workflows

Start by identifying the core workflows that are central to your engineering projects. This involves:

- Mapping Out Processes: Use KanBo’s Spaces to visually map out and represent each significant workflow or project. Spaces offer a customizable canvas where tasks are organized, providing a macro-view of the project structure.

- Defining Objectives: Clearly define the objectives and deliverables of each workflow to align efforts with strategic goals.

- Breaking Down Tasks: Use Cards within each Space to break down large processes into manageable tasks, ensuring a granular approach to project management.

Step 2: Assign Resources

Efficient resource management is vital for engineering projects:

- Utilize Resource Management: Assign resources using KanBo’s resource management features. This involves allocating internal employees, contractors, machines, or rooms to specific tasks based on skills, availability, and project requirements.

- Manage Work Schedules: Configure resource attributes such as work schedules, skills, and locations to optimize allocations and minimize conflicts.

- Monitor Utilization: Regularly check resource utilization dashboards to ensure workload balance and prevent over-allocation.

Step 3: Integrate Data Sources

Centralize your data within KanBo for seamless workflow management:

- Connect External Systems: Link KanBo with external systems like HR or ERP for automatic data updates on resource availability, holidays, and more.

- Consolidate Information: Use KanBo as the central hub for all documentation, communication, and data related to projects, reducing the burden of managing multiple information sources.

- Leverage Analytics: Utilize KanBo’s reporting and analytics tools to gain insights from your aggregated data, helping you track KPIs and make informed decisions.

Step 4: Configure Cards for Tracking Progress

Make full use of Cards to track and manage tasks effectively:

- Detail Task Information: Ensure each Card contains comprehensive task details, such as notes, files, and checklists, to provide clarity and context.

- Set and Monitor Statuses: Use Card statuses (To Do, In Progress, Completed) to monitor the lifecycle of tasks and calculate project progress accurately.

- Manage Dependencies: Establish Card relations to sequence tasks logically (parent-child, next-previous), ensuring a clear workflow hierarchy.

Step 5: Support Continuous Improvement

Continuously refine workflows and processes to adapt to changes:

- Adjust on the Fly: Use KanBo’s flexibility to make real-time adjustments to workflows as project conditions change, ensuring agility in your processes.

- Identify Bottlenecks: Predict potential bottlenecks using KanBo’s visualisation tools and address them proactively to maintain workflow efficiency.

- Explore Opportunities: Analyze project data to identify areas of improvement or opportunities for innovation, leveraging insights to enhance future projects.

Glossary of Terms

- Workspace

- A collection that organizes Spaces relevant to a project, team, or topic. Workspaces can be configured as Private, Public, or Org-wide, with access control tailored through assigned roles like Owner, Member, or Visitor.

- Space

- A visual representation of workflows within a Workspace that manages and tracks tasks through Cards. Spaces can be used for specific projects or areas of focus to facilitate teamwork and task management.

- Card

- The primary unit of KanBo, representing tasks or actionable items. Cards hold notes, files, comments, checklists, and can be adapted to fit a variety of needs and project goals.

- Card Status

- Indicates the current stage of a task, such as "To Do" or "Completed". This categorization aids in understanding work progress and assessing project timelines and outcomes.

- Card Relation

- Defines dependencies between Cards, allowing users to manage task sequences. Relations can be parent-child or next-previous to set priority and task flow.

- Card Issue

- Identifies problems with Cards that hinder management, marked with colors like orange for time conflicts or red for blocking issues.

- Card Grouping

- A feature allowing users to organize Cards based on criteria such as status, assignment, or due date, facilitating efficient task visualization and management.

- Card Statistics

- Provides analytical insights into a Card’s lifecycle, using visual charts and data summaries to reflect task completion and efforts over time.

- Hybrid Environment

- The flexibility of deploying KanBo using both on-premises and cloud solutions, balancing data security and accessibility according to organizational needs.

- GCC High Cloud Installation

- A secure deployment option for regulated industries through Microsoft’s GCC High Cloud, meeting compliance with standards such as FedRAMP and ITAR.

- Resource Management

- A system within KanBo to allocate and manage resources like employees, machines, and materials, ensuring optimal utilization and cost control.

- Time Tracking

- The process of logging time spent on tasks by resources, allowing for comparison against forecasts to identify efficiencies and over-allocations.

- Conflict Management

- Mechanisms within KanBo that highlight resource allocation conflicts, enabling proactive resolution of scheduling issues.

- Integration

- Deep integration capabilities with Microsoft environments, supporting seamless workflows across different tools and platforms for enhanced user experience.

- Data Visualisation

- Features that allow monitoring of resource allocation, project progress, and potential bottlenecks through intuitive dashboards and charts.
